The focus of Parents, Children and Divorce is to help married and unmarried couples  with children handle the many challenges of divorce.

Some of the topics covered are:

  • Divorce Terms You Will Need To Know
  • The Impact Of Divorce On Children
  • Children At Risk
  • Seeing Divorce Though Your Children's Eyes
  • Stages Of Loss And Grief
  • Parents Who Have Never Parented Together
  • Parenting Time And Parental Sharing
  • Developing A Parenting Plan
  • Domestic Violence
  • Counseling
  • Mediation
  • Families In Transition
